Book excerpt: A series of women are found raped and strangled in the Chelsea district of Manhattan with a number of unusual clues connecting the cases. Assigned to the case is Matt Davis, a plodding homicide detective hopelessly addicted to fly fishing, assisted by his one-quarter Mohawk Indian partner, Chris Freitag, and a female detective named Rita Valdez.

As Paris reveals, divorce has improved dramatically in recent decades due to changes in laws and family structures, advances in psychology and child development, and a new understanding of the importance of the father. Book excerpt: EBONY is the flagship magazine of Johnson Publishing. Founded in 1945 by John H. Johnson, it still maintains the highest global circulation of any African American-focused magazine.
